Understanding Cell-Mediated Immunity

To maintain a strong defense against pathogens, it’s important to understand the role of specialized immune responses in protecting our health. The human body uses a complex network powered by distinct immune cells, particularly T-cells, to identify and neutralize infected or damaged cells.

Cytotoxic T-cells proficiently target and eliminate cells harbouring harmful viruses, while T-helper cells are crucial for activating other immune components to improve response efficiency. Additionally, dendritic cells act as key antigen-presenting cells, enhancing T-cell recognition through effective antigen presentation, thereby sharpening the immune response.

This intricate interaction is vital for developing effective immunity against infections, monitoring for neoplasms, and addressing chronic conditions. The Role Of T-Cell In Defense

Understanding specialized immune responses is vital. T cells play a crucial role in defending against pathogens. These white blood cells are essential for the body's reaction to infection and are classified into four main types. Each type has unique functions that improve our overall health.

Helper T cells activate and coordinate other immune components, amplifying the body's response to harmful pathogens.

Cytotoxic T cells directly target and destroy cells infected by a virus or that have become cancerous. This function is key to cell-mediated immunity.

Regulatory T cells help establish immune tolerance, preventing autoimmune conditions. In contrast, Memory T cells offer long-term protection and ensure a quick response when the body reencounters familiar antigens.

Enhancing Antibody Production

Strengthening the body's defense mechanisms is vital for overall health. One of the most crucial processes is the generation of antibodies by B cells, which play a key role in identifying and neutralizing various pathogens, including viruses. Effective humoral immunity allows the body to remember past infections, enabling rapid responses to new threats.

Vaccination is significant in promoting this immune response. By introducing specific antigens, vaccines effectively stimulate the adaptive immune system, producing antibodies without causing disease. This process has notably improved public health by reducing outbreaks and enhancing community protection against infectious diseases.

Importance Of Innate Immunity

Innate immunity refers to the body's natural defense system that acts as the first line of protection against harmful organisms. This essential mechanism includes various components, such as physical barriers like skin and mucous membranes, which prevent pathogens from entering the body.

Key cells involved in this initial defense include specialized white blood cells, essential for quickly identifying and responding to infections. Their role is vital, enabling fast recognition of threats and the rapid initiation of responses aimed at neutralizing them, such as the activation of phagocytes and the release of cytokines.

This protective system operates quickly, engaging inflammatory responses that address immediate dangers. Unlike later stages of the immune response that rely on prior exposure, the innate immune system works automatically to combat threats as they arise.

Furthermore, maintaining the health of these critical immune cells is vital for ensuring effective innate immunity. Healthy cells enhance the body's ability to respond to pathogens and significantly improve resilience against infections and diseases.

How Cytokines Support Immunity

Understanding the role of cytokines highlights the significance of vaccination and nutritional support discussed earlier. These molecules are crucial for establishing communication among cells that shield the body from harmful pathogens. By mediating essential signalling processes, cytokines ensure that the body's initial defences and long-term responses are well-coordinated, leading to suitable reactions against infections.

Cytokines support immunity by signalling the bone marrow to produce immune cells that help fight infections. They bind to and induce receptor activation on an infected cell, triggering the immune response needed to eliminate pathogens and restore balance.

Activation of Immune Cells

Cytokines activate T cells, helping them mature into effector cells that can actively target and neutralize foreign antigens. Furthermore, these essential proteins stimulate B cells, which produce antibodies necessary for creating immunological memory, allowing the body to respond faster to future infections.

The Connection Between Inflammation And Immunity

Understanding how the body reacts to injury and infection emphasizes inflammation's vital role in health. A healthy immune response depends on the activation of various immune cells, which produce inflammation necessary for protection and healing.

During acute responses, immune cells engage to fight pathogens and aid recovery. However, chronic inflammation can weaken your body's defenses, making it less capable of effectively responding to infections or external threats.

Chronic inflammation disrupts the balance within immune responses, hindering protective mechanisms essential for combating pathogens. This imbalance can negatively impact antibody production and effector cells' functionality, leading to adverse health effects. Vitamins A, C, and D are crucial for maintaining a healthy inflammatory response, supporting the immune system, and promoting overall health.
